Step 1
Add the chicken breasts, and enchilada sauce to your slow cooker. Cover and cook on HIGH for 4 hours or LOW for 8 hours.
Step 2
Shred the chicken breasts with two forks right in the slow cooker.
Step 3
Add the sour cream and half of the cheese, stir.
Step 4
Stir in the crushed doritos, reserving a ½ cup for the top.
Step 5
Sprinkle the rest of the cheese on the top, the olives and the remaining crushed doritos.
Step 6
Cover, and turn slow cooker to HIGH for 30 minutes.
Step 7
Serve and enjoy!
